WebLearn how to say 'harass' in English with audio and example in sentences WebWord Origin. early 17th cent.: from French harasser, from harer ‘set a dog on’, from Germanic hare, a cry urging a dog to attack. See harass in the Oxford Advanced American …
Webharass, a 17th-century borrowing from French, has traditionally been pronounced in English as [har-uh s], /ˈhær əs/, with stress on the first syllable. Webharass in American English (həˈræs, ˈhærəs) transitive verb 1. to disturb persistently; torment, as with troubles or cares; bother continually; pester; persecute 2. to trouble by repeated attacks, incursions, etc., as in war or hostilities; harry; raid SYNONYMS 1. badger, vex, plague, hector torture. See worry. 2. molest. Web1. : to annoy or bother (someone) in a constant or repeated way. She was constantly harassed by the other students. He claims that he is being unfairly harassed by the police. He was accused of sexually harassing his secretary.
